Menu
Home
About
Contact
More
Home
About
Contact
More
Richard G. Glogau, MD INC
350 Parnassus Avenue, Suite 400
San Francisco,California
94117,USA
Phone : 415-564-1261
Fax : 415-564-1967
frontdesk@sfderm.com
Create your website for free!
This website was made with Webnode.
Create your own
for free today!
Get started